Simple Daily Habits That Improve Oral Microbiome Balance Naturally

The human mouth is home to an astonishing array of bacteria, many of which play crucial roles in maintaining oral health. The oral microbiome is a complex ecosystem that can greatly impact not only oral hygiene but also overall well-being. Factors such as diet, hygiene practices, and lifestyle choices affect this delicate balance. Fostering a healthy oral microbiome can be achieved through simple daily habits, leading to better oral health and reducing the risk of periodontal disease, cavities, and other oral issues.

One of the most straightforward ways to improve your oral microbiome balance is through diet. Incorporating a variety of fruits and vegetables into your meals can have a significant impact. Foods rich in fiber, such as apples, carrots, and celery, help stimulate saliva production, which is vital for neutralizing acids in the mouth and washing away food particles. Additionally, these crunchy foods have natural cleaning properties that can aid in reducing plaque buildup, creating a more hospitable environment for beneficial bacteria.

Moreover, fermented foods can play a pivotal role in enhancing the oral microbiome. Foods like y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ut, and kimchi are loaded with probiotics—beneficial bacteria that promote gut health and have a similar effect in the oral cavity. Regular consumption of these foods can help compete with harmful bacteria, boosting your oral microbiome’s resilience. It’s essential, however, to choose low-sugar options to avoid feeding detrimental bacteria that thrive on sugars.

Equally important is maintaining proper hydration. Drinking plenty of water throughout the day not only helps to keep your body functioning optimally but also aids oral health. Saliva is your mouth’s natural defense mechanism, and staying hydrated ensures that your body produces enough of it. Saliva contains enzymes and proteins that help break down food particles, neutralize acids, and wash away harmful bacteria. If you’re frequently dehydrated, you risk creating a dry mouth that can lead to an imbalance of oral bacteria.

Oral hygiene practices are fundamental to sustaining a healthy microbiome. Brushing your teeth twice a day and flossing regularly is a must. However, it’s crucial to use the right techniques and tools. Opt for fluoride toothpaste that doesn’t contain harsh ingredients, as they can disrupt the balance of your oral microbiome. Natural mouthwashes can also be beneficial. Consider using products free from alcohol and artificial additives to avoid disturbing your microbiome’s balance.

In addition to brushing and flossing, consider how you use dental products throughout your day. Reducing the consumption of antibacterial mouthwashes and gums that contain artificial sweeteners can help maintain a healthy microbial balance. Frequent use of such products can strip the mouth of beneficial bacteria. Instead, you might consider natural options that allow beneficial bacteria to thrive while still providing a clean feeling.

Another habit worth adopting is mindful eating. Chewing food thoroughly and taking your time when eating can enhance saliva production and improve digestion, which subsequently contributes to a healthier oral microbiome. Avoiding snacking on sugary or processed foods too frequently can help reduce the risk of cavities and oral bacterial imbalance. Whenever possible, opt for healthier snacks, such as nuts, seeds, or raw vegetables.

Lastly, minimizing stress through daily relaxation practices can indirectly support your oral microbiome. Chronic stress can lead to unfavorable changes in your saliva and can also influence your eating habits. Incorporating activities like deep breathing, meditation, or yoga into your routine can help manage stress levels, benefiting your overall health and improving your oral microbiome.
